Hyderabad Nov 24: Election for 12 MLC elections under local bodies quota will be conducted in Telangana State on Dec 27. The commission said that results will be announced on Dec 30. The EC said that a notification will be issued on Dec 2to receive applications by Dec 9, scrutiny on 10 and withdrawals on 12. The commission said that the elections will be conducted for 2 MLC seats each in Mahabubnagar, Ranga Reddy and Karimnagar and one seat each in Adilabad, Nizamabad, Medak, Nalgond and Warangal districts. Election code will be implemented in all districts except Hyderabad the commission said.
